These rails-to-trails bike paths throughout the USA are perfect for a simple and car-free bicycle camping trip.  Tap to see the trails!

COWBOY TRAIL

Enjoy 200 miles of wide open spaces and agricultural land across Nebraska on this off-the-beaten-track rail trail conversion.

NEBRASKA

KATY TRAIL

Cross hilly Missouri the flat way: 237 miles through prairie and farmland along the Missouri River on the longest continuous rail trail conversion in the US.

MISSOURI

OHIO TO ERIE

Over 300 miles of paved, car-free bicycle path from Cincinnati to Cleveland connecting small towns, big cities, farmland, and nature preserves.

OHIO

GAP TRAIL

The Great Allegheny Passage is 150 miles of premier gravel rail trail passing through bicycle-friendly small towns and over the Eastern Continental Divide.

PENNSYLVANIA, MARYLAND

C&O CANAL

Follow this historic canal towpath for 185 miles past old canal locks, beautiful scenery, and dozens of free hiker-biker campsites as you make your way to D.C.

MARYLAND, WASHINGTON D.C.

PALOUSE TO CASCADES

One of few long rail trail bike paths out west, this historic trail includes a 2 mile long tunnel beneath Snoqualmie Pass, the longest trail tunnel in the US!

WASHINGTON
